This year I spent the month of August at Kuakini Medical Center in Honolulu, Hawaii, studying Hyperbaric and Diving medicine I was able help treat scuba divers who had suffered accidents while diving. In one incidence a 20-year- old male arrived with severe cognitive deficits and left sided weakness after suffering a cerebral air gas embolism after a rapid ascent after running out of air. It was amazing to see how hyperbaric therapy could take a young person with stroke like symptoms and return them to baseline fairly rapidly. During this time I also became a certified scuba diver.
In April this year, I plan on helping to run the Wilderness Medicine Elective for medical students. The elective is two weeks. The first week involves lectures on wilderness medicine, simulations, and skill sessions in Rhode Island, while the second week we continue this but head up to the White Mountains. In August, I designed a 2-week elective in the Clinical Informatics department. I'm interested in health information technology (IT) from a policy perspective, so it was important for me to learn about implementation of IT systems on the ground. For my second elective as part of my ACEP-EMRA health policy mini-fellowship, I will spend March 2012 in Washington, DC participating in public policy events with ACEP staff members. This will likely include attending congressional committee hearings, meeting with elected representatives and their staff, and participating in discussions with policy analysts at agencies such as CMS, AHRQ, and the Office of the National Coordinator for Health Information Technology (ONC). During this time I hope to learn about the implementation of Accountable Care Organizations (ACO) and develop materials for ACEP to promote federal support for health IT expansion among emergency departments nationwide.

I plan to go to Nicaragua and further develop a relationship between our emergency department and the relatively new (10yrs) emergency medicine residencies at the two large public hospitals in Managua. One hospital is mostly medical and contains the only cath lab in the country for the public sector, while the other is considered the trauma hospital and holds the CT Scanner. The idea is to establish a long-term relationship focusing on health-care capacity building through resident education. In addition to clinical work, I'll take Spanish Classes at Viva Spanish School and live with a host family. For my other elective, I plan to go to Cuba and study a health care system that is radically different from our own.
